Why the Framing Is Backwards<\/a><\/p><\/blockquote>\n<h2>Term Structures<\/h2>\n<p>If you trade options, term structures are part of your daily workflow. You can trade weekly, monthly, and quarterly expirations on the same underlying. The term structure itself contains information: the relationship between short-term and long-term implied volatility tells you something about market expectations for upcoming catalysts, seasonal patterns, and structural risk.<\/p>\n<p>Prediction markets have some early term structure for recurring events. You can trade Fed rate contracts across multiple upcoming FOMC meetings simultaneously. But the depth and continuity lag far behind options. There&#8217;s no equivalent of the weekly\/monthly\/quarterly expiration series that options traders use for calendar spreads and term structure analysis. You get a handful of discrete event dates, not a rich multi-expiration curve to analyze.<\/p>\n<h3>Where it\u2019s headed<\/h3>\n<p>This is a natural next step for exchanges competing for institutional volume. Kalshi and Polymarket are both expanding their contract offerings rapidly. Recurring economic events like monthly inflation readings, quarterly GDP reports, and regular Fed meetings are obvious candidates for rolling contract series. Some early versions of this are already visible in how both platforms handle sequential economic data releases. As the volume of available contracts grows, the ingredients for meaningful term structures will fall into place.<\/p>\n<h2>Scalar Markets: Beyond Binary<\/h2>\n<p>Today\u2019s prediction markets are almost exclusively binary: will this happen, yes or no? This is powerful for directional views on specific events, but it limits the expressiveness of the instrument compared to options, where the payoff varies with the magnitude of the underlying\u2019s move.<\/p>\n<p>This will change. Both Kalshi and Polymarket have built support for scalar markets into their exchange architecture. Scalar markets ask \u201cwhat will the value be?\u201d rather than \u201cwill this happen?\u201d and allow contracts across a continuous range of outcomes. A scalar prediction market on the S&amp;P 500\u2019s year-end level would create a probability distribution across outcome ranges. It would look remarkably like an options chain, but with direct, transparent probability pricing instead of implied volatility calculations.<\/p>\n<p>Scalar market types already appear in exchange APIs, signaling clear directional intent even if the timeline for full deployment remains uncertain. Given the pace of development at both major exchanges and the clear demand from institutional participants, scalar markets are a \u201cwhen\u201d not an \u201cif.\u201d And when they arrive, they fundamentally expand what\u2019s possible\u2014bringing prediction markets much closer to the expressiveness that options traders need.<\/p>\n<blockquote class=\"cross-ref\"><p>For how binary payoffs currently compare to options payoffs: <a href=\"https:\/\/quantcha.com\/news\/binary-contracts-vs-puts-and-calls\/\">Binary Contracts vs. Puts and Calls<\/a><\/p><\/blockquote>\n<h2>Rolling and Continuous Strategies<\/h2>\n<p>Many popular options strategies depend on continuous execution across multiple expirations. Exchanges could even build explicit roll functionality that automatically transitions a position from one contract to the next, similar to how futures platforms handle contract rolling today.<\/p>\n<blockquote class=\"cross-ref\"><p>For more on what works today for income-focused investors and what\u2019s coming: <a href=\"https:\/\/quantcha.com\/news\/income-strategies-prediction-markets\/\">Income Strategies in Prediction Markets: What Works Today and What&#8217;s Coming<\/a><\/p><\/blockquote>\n<h2>Contract Granularity and Event Types<\/h2>\n<p>An options trader on a major stock can choose from hundreds or thousands of strike-expiration combinations. Prediction markets currently offer a fraction of this granularity.<\/p>\n<p>The market has evolved beyond simple yes\/no propositions into several structural varieties: single-outcome, multiple-outcome, categorical, range, cumulative, and spread events. Each type creates different analytical opportunities.<\/p>\n<h3>Cumulative Thresholds as a Bridge to Scalar<\/h3>\n<p>Cumulative markets deserve special attention because they\u2019re the closest thing to an options strike chain available today. Contracts like \u201cFed funds rate above 3%\u201d, \u201cabove 4%\u201d, and \u201cabove 5%\u201d on the same event create a de facto strike chain. You can build vertical spreads, sell the tails for iron condor-like structures, and construct defined-risk positions that feel familiar to options income traders. When these cumulative thresholds exist across multiple settlement dates, you get something approaching an expiration cycle.<\/p>\n<p>Cumulative markets are a meaningful bridge between today\u2019s binary landscape and the full scalar market future. They\u2019re tradeable now, and they reward the kind of spread analysis that options traders already do.<\/p>\n<blockquote class=\"cross-ref\"><p>For specific strategies using cumulative thresholds: <a href=\"https:\/\/quantcha.com\/news\/income-strategies-prediction-markets\/\">Income Strategies in Prediction Markets: What Works Today and What&#8217;s Coming<\/a><\/p><\/blockquote>\n<h3>Spread Events and Pair Trading<\/h3>\n<p>Spread markets, currently most common in sports, compare two outcomes directly: \u201cWill Team A beat Team B by more than 7?\u201d Conceptually, this is pair trading\u2014a direct relative-value bet without needing to construct a long\/short position in separate instruments.<\/p>\n<p>The interesting possibility is extending spread markets beyond sports. A contract like \u201cWill Stock X outperform Stock Y by more than 500bps this quarter?\u201d would offer direct, transparent relative value without the complexity of constructing a long\/short equity position. This is speculative, but the structural framework already exists and the extension to financial markets is natural.<\/p>\n<h3>Where it\u2019s headed<\/h3>\n<p>Scalar markets will be the biggest driver of improved granularity. We envision the platform evolving into the single place investors go to analyze, monitor, and trade predictions, equities, options, crypto, and more with robust support for cross-portfolio and cross-asset metrics and analytics.<\/p>\n<h2>The Underlying Asset Question<\/h2>\n<p>Options derive their value from an underlying asset you can separately own and trade. Prediction market contracts have no separately tradeable underlying. This is structural rather than a maturity issue.<\/p>\n<p>But this isn\u2019t necessarily a limitation. It\u2019s a different design. Prediction markets give you direct exposure to the event itself, without the noise of a proxy instrument. The strategic framework is different: it centers on relative value between correlated contracts, portfolio construction across independent events, and position sizing based on estimated edge.<\/p>\n<h2>Market Making and Liquidity<\/h2>\n<p>Liquid options markets depend on dedicated market makers who continuously post bids and offers. Prediction market market-making infrastructure is still developing.<\/p>\n<h3>Where it\u2019s headed<\/h3>\n<p>This is one of the gaps closing fastest. Major trading firms including Susquehanna and DRW are building dedicated prediction market desks. Kalshi\u2019s FIX protocol connectivity and margin trading are explicitly designed to attract institutional market makers. ICE invested $1.6 billion in Polymarket. The economic incentives are strong, and the infrastructure is being built at speed. As these participants enter, spreads will tighten, depth will increase, and execution quality will improve across the board.<\/p>\n<h2>The Big Picture<\/h2>\n<p>What strikes me most about prediction markets in 2026 is how much the trajectory resembles options markets fifteen years ago.
